History

Kingston University London was established in 1889 in Kingston upon Thames, Surrey, the United Kingdom and aims to develop students’ potential, bring a transformative change into their life, and improves society. The university, which attracts students from across the globe, provides students with numerous degree programmes. Students can select a programme that reflects their interests and can help them meet the demands of working in a modern workplace setting. The UK university has four campuses, which are situated in and around the city of the Thames.

The Thames is London’s student-friendly borough with a train ride just half an hour or 30 minutes away from the capital. Other interesting facts include the university ranked in the United Kingdom’s top 40 Universities in the 2021 Guardian University Guide. Kingston University London is the top UK university for designs and crafts, covering creative and cultural sectors, interior design, graphic design, animation, product design, furniture design, and illustration. The university ranks third in the United Kingdom and first in London for fashion, textiles, and education.

It ranks seventh in the United Kingdom and first in London for pharmacology and pharmacy, journalism, sports science, publishing, and public relations. It ranks in first place in London for biosciences and midwifery and nursing, which it runs with the St. George’s University of London. The Business of Fashion listings has ranked the university’s fashion programme as one of the best in the world. Kingston University London is one of the top universities in London and is one of the top 200 young universities around the world. Since its establishment, Kingston University London has earned a stellar reputation among both national and international students.

In REF2021, 23% of Kingston’s research was rated the highest international quality (4*), up from 16% in REF2014. Kingston also came in fifth of the 14 universities that comprise the University Alliance.

More than seventy per cent of all research was scored either a 4 or a 3 in five different Assessment Units. They were Art and Design, Allied Health, the Performing Arts, Computer Science, and Language. Most of the submitted works in art and design were considered to be of the highest possible calibre.

Scholarships

Kingston University London provides international scholarships to students from abroad worth up to £2,000 for the first year. The scholarship is for the September intake and is offered to students enrolled in their undergraduate or postgraduate programme.

The university also offers an alumni discount of 10% on the tuition fee for a graduated undergrad taking a postgraduate programme at the university. Postgraduate progression scholarship provides students with 15% off on their tuition fee for undergraduates starting their postgraduate programme immediately from the university, but it can’t be combined with the alumni discount.

Kingston School of Art Sino-British Fellowship Trust bursary offers students doing their Masters in Curating Contemporary Design £10,000 in research funds for students carrying out their research projects in the United Kingdom or China.

Facilities & Services

Kingston University London provides students with an ambassadorship programme with 600 roles available for students to fill. The student ambassador programme offers training, competitive pay, and flexibility.

The university also offers numerous local part-time jobs from social care to sports coaching through the job affairs they host. The university assigns each student a personal tutor to help them manage their work. You can visit the Academic Success Centre, which each faculty provides to its students, for confidential advice.

Students who need to improve their language and academic skills can choose from several tutorials and courses. Kingston University London provides tutoring and drop-in sessions for students with learning differences.

Accommodations

Self-catered accommodation costs £4,960 to £16,500 each year.

All first-year undergraduate students studying full-time at the KingstonUniversity London received guaranteed living accommodation for the September enrolment period. There are 2,440 rooms in the halls of residence with most rooms featuring en-suite facilities. Flats can accommodate up to eight students.

The halls are on or near the main campuses of the university. Students can take inter-site bus service for free to roam around the town of Kingston. Students searching for rental living accommodation out of the university can consult with the university to aid them in their search. The university also manages local properties in the area. International or EU students enrolled at the UK university for less than one year and for the first time can reserve a room in lodgings.

Transport

Students can take the inter-site bus service free of charge to travel around the university easily. The bus service is environmentally-friendly and has a mobile tracker and disabled access. Students can rent an electronic bike to travel between Kingston Hills and Penrhyn Road. The university’s transport links feature two train stations, motorways, and a network of busses that make the commute easier. The Heathrow and Gatwick international airports are easily accessible from the university via public transport and road.
